CVE-2026-27775 records a High severity (CVSS 8.8) vulnerability in Gitea pre-receive hook permission cache allows full repository write access. The current sources do not mark it as known exploited. Gitea 1.25.5 caches a branch-specific write-permission result across multiple refs in one pre-receive hook session, allowing a per-branch maintainer-edit grant to be reused for other refs and escalate to full repository write access.
